Dugan told MLB.com that he's made a habit of catching foul balls and sharing them with kids in the stadium at Tigers games since returning to his hometown of Detroit in 1984.
"I enjoy it," he said. "t's just fun for the kids and fun for me. Not saying I'll run over a kid for a ball or anything! But they are taking numbers on who gets the next ball. It's fun."
While his haul of five balls during Monday's game against the Pittsburgh Pirates was impressive, Dugan said he once caught a total of eight foul balls between batting practice and a game in 2002.
"I have a waiting list of kids," Dugan said. "The kids are showing other kids where 'the seat' is if they want a foul ball."
